    Brooke Dierdoff Decisions Mia St. John in The Rematch

    Brooke Dierdoff defeated Mia St. John for the second time, and this time took Mia's WBC International Lightweight Title, in Victoria Tamaulipas, by unanimous decision. [details]

      Dierdorff Dirtiest Fighter In Women's Boxing

      Mia St. John kept the bullrushing Brooke Dierdorff at bay for the first two rounds by boxing well. In the third round, Dierdorff resorted to body checking to get past St. John's jabs. Dierdorff used headbutts, one of her common weapons and criticized by several of her opponents, to damage the left side of St. John's face. St. John needed stitches.

      The referee issued only one headbutt warning to Dierdorff but St. John was already cut. The referee did not have control of the fight.
